Patent number: 8878218Abstract: The invention provides semiconductor light-emitting devices which have a semiconductor layer on a principal surface of a translucent substrate and a reflective layer on a second principal surface opposite to the principal surface having the semiconductor layer, which enables that the peeling of the reflective layer from the translucent substrate is suppressed. A semiconductor light-emitting device includes a first metal layer disposed in contact with a second principal surface of a translucent substrate, a second metal layer disposed in contact with at least the second principal surface or a side surface of the translucent substrate around the first metal layer, and a third metal layer disposed on the second metal layer. The first metal layer has a reflectance with respect to a peak wavelength of light emitted from an emitting layer higher than the reflectance of the second metal layer.Type: GrantFiled: October 16, 2013Date of Patent: November 4, 2014Assignee: Nichia CorporationInventors: Kosuke Sato, Yoshitaka Sumitomo, Dai Wakamatsu, Yoshiyuki Aihara, Kimihiro Miyamoto, Satoshi Kinoshita

Publication number: 20140183564Abstract: A light emitting element includes a first conductivity-type semiconductor layer, a first electrode, a second conductivity-type semiconductor layer and a second electrode. The second conductivity-type semiconductor layer has a square peripheral shape. The first electrode includes a first connecting portion on a first diagonal line and a first extending portion extending from the first connecting portion onto the first diagonal line. The second electrode includes a second connecting portion on the first diagonal line facing the first connecting portion via the first extending portion. Two second extending portions extend from the second connecting portion and having a first portion and a second portion respectively. The first connecting portion includes an end portion closer to the second connecting portion than a straight line intersecting the tip ends of the two second extending portions, and a center portion at a side father from the second connecting portion than the second diagonal line.Type: ApplicationFiled: December 20, 2013Publication date: July 3, 2014Applicant: NICHIA CORPORATIONInventor: Kosuke SATO

Publication number: 20140152774Abstract: A vehicle periphery monitoring device includes a first bird's-eye view image generation section generating a first bird's-eye view image through a two-dimensional plane projective transformation based on a photographed image acquired by an in-vehicle camera module, a second bird's-eye view image generation section generating a second bird's-eye view image through a three-dimensional plane projective transformation based on the photographed image, and a displaying image generation section generating a first displaying image for monitor displaying from the first bird's-eye view image and a second displaying image for monitor displaying having a higher displaying magnification than the first displaying image, from a predetermined area of the second bird's-eye view image corresponding to a predetermined area of the first bird's-eye view image.Type: ApplicationFiled: August 21, 2012Publication date: June 5, 2014Applicant: AISIN SEIKI KABUSHIKI KAISHAInventors: Haruki Wakabayashi, Kosuke Sato, Kinji Yamamoto, Shoko Takeda

Patent number: 8599043Abstract: A parking assist apparatus includes a parking target position setting section for setting a parking target position when a vehicle is to be parked by reversing, a parking pathway determining section for determining possibility/impossibility of direct parking for parking the vehicle to the parking target position without turnaround, and a report outputting section for effecting reporting to allow a driver engaged in parking to recognize the possibility/impossibility of the direct parking based on the result of determination by the parking pathway determining section.Type: GrantFiled: February 15, 2010Date of Patent: December 3, 2013Assignee: Aisin Seiki Kabushiki KaishaInventors: Jun Kadowaki, Kazuya Watanabe, Yu Tanaka, Kosuke Sato, Atsuo Fukaya, Hiroyuki Tachibana, Motokatsu Tomozawa, Kenji Kodera

Patent number: 8115811Abstract: An image around a vehicle matching the intent of a driver is automatically displayed. An infrared camera (2) picks up an image of the face of a driver (7). A visual line direction and a face direction are detected from the face image of the driver (7). Based on the visual line direction of the driver (7) and the face direction thereof, a direction in which the driver (7) gazes is detected. When the direction in which the driver (7) gazes is included in image pickup ranges of CCD cameras (1A, 1B, and 1C), an image around a vehicle (100) picked up by any one of the CCD cameras (1A, 1B, and 1C) is automatically displayed on a monitor (6).Type: GrantFiled: November 8, 2006Date of Patent: February 14, 2012Assignee: Aisin Seiki Kabushiki KaishaInventors: Takashi Hiramaki, Jun Adachi, Kazuya Watanabe, Kosuke Sato

Patent number: 8045151Abstract: A first inspection process of inspecting presence of a defect on a front surface of a film body with a protective film separated therefrom; a separator removing process of separating a separator from the inspected laminated film; a second inspection process of inspecting presence of the defect in the film body in a vertical attitude while introducing the film body with the separator separated and removed therefrom to a film travel path directed in a vertical direction, and storing detection data; a separator laminating process and a protective film laminating process of laminating a separator and a protective film to a back surface and a front surface of the inspected film body, respectively; and a film collecting process of winding up the inspected laminated film laminated with the protective film and the separator are provided.Type: GrantFiled: August 12, 2008Date of Patent: October 25, 2011Assignee: Nitto Denko CorporationInventors: Hiromichi Ohashi, Kosuke Sato

Patent number: 8031225Abstract: A soundings monitoring system for a vehicle includes a first camera capturing a fist imaging surface, a second camera capturing a second imaging surface, and a monitor for displaying a first image of the first imaging surface and a second image of the second imaging surface. A standard point is specified relative to the vehicle, the first image and the second image are synthesized and displayed on the monitor so that a coordinate position of the standard point in an expanded imaging surface from the first imaging surface and a coordinate position of the standard point in the second imaging surface match each other, and an imaginary line including the standard point and extending over the first image and the second image is displayed on the monitor in such a manner that the imaginary line is superimposed on the synthesized image of the first image and the second image.Type: GrantFiled: November 13, 2006Date of Patent: October 4, 2011Assignee: Aisin Seiki Kabushiki KaishaInventors: Kazuya Watanabe, Kosuke Sato

Patent number: 7825828Abstract: A parking assist device includes a monitor (10) for displaying a captured image from a camera (12), assist information output means for providing assistance during introduction of a vehicle into a parking position, and correction control means (31) for correcting an inappropriate operation performed when the vehicle is introduced into the parking position. When a steering operation, an accelerator operation, or a brake operation is inappropriate, the correction control means (31) performs control to correct the travel course and the stop position. Thus, even if the driver performs an inappropriate operation when introducing the vehicle into the parking position, the driver can appropriately introduce the vehicle into the parking position according to the display on the monitor (10).Type: GrantFiled: November 16, 2006Date of Patent: November 2, 2010Assignees: Aisin Seiki Kabushiki Kaisha, Toyota Jidosha Kabushiki KaishaInventors: Kazuya Watanabe, Kosuke Sato, Hiroshi Yamauchi

Publication number: 20090265061Abstract: Driving assistance is provided to a vehicle driver in a manner that is easy to understand and at a low cost. At a driving assistance device (100), an image processing unit (103) sets a cut-out region within image data photographed by a camera (121) and extracts cut-out image data. A control unit (107) generates information indicating risk to the rear of the vehicle based on the position and speed of other vehicle measured by a distance measuring unit. The image processing unit (103) then outputs information indicating the cut-out image data and the risk to a monitor (123). The image processing unit (103) then moves the cut-out region to a direction in which a vehicle route has changed when a receiving unit (105) receives notification to the effect that the route of the vehicle has changed.Type: ApplicationFiled: November 9, 2007Publication date: October 22, 2009Applicant: AISIN SEIKI KABUSHIKI KAISHAInventors: Kazuya Watanabe, Masaya Otokawa, Yu Tanaka, Tsuyoshi Kuboyama, Kosuke Sato, Jun Kadowaki

Patent number: 7598887Abstract: A parking assist apparatus includes a monitor displaying an image captured by a camera mounted to a vehicle for capturing an image in a moving direction of the vehicle and an assist information output device outputting assist information for assisting a parking operation and displaying the assist information on the monitor, wherein the assist information output device: calculates a locus for guiding the vehicle to a parking position specified on the image displayed on the monitor; sets a target position on the locus for guiding the vehicle to the parking position; outputs guide information corresponding to the target position so as to be displayed on the locus in the image displayed on the monitor; and outputs a navigation mark corresponding to a current position of the vehicle so as to be displayed on the monitor.Type: GrantFiled: December 18, 2006Date of Patent: October 6, 2009Assignee: Aisin Seiki Kabushiki KaishaInventors: Kosuke Sato, Kazuya Watanabe
